In a world where childhood imagination reigns supreme, "The Little Green Goblin" by James Ball Naylor invites readers into a whimsical adventure. Set against the backdrop of the early 20th century, this enchanting children's fantasy novel follows Bob Taylor, a boy yearning for excitement beyond his mundane life. When he encounters Fitz Mee, a mischievous goblin, their journey unfolds with delightful escapades and valuable lessons about friendship and courage. Unique elements such as the vibrant portrayal of fantastical creatures and the exploration of inner desires make this tale a timeless treasure. Ideal for young readers and parents alike, this story sparks creativity and wonder, reminding us all of the magic that lies within our imaginations.
